    Brady agrees new deal
    Friday, 7 March 2008 13:16
    Liam Brady today agreed a two-year deal to become an assistant to new Republic of Ireland manager Giovanni Trapattoni.

    Brady, who played under Trapattoni in the early 1980s at Juventus, met with the 68-year-old Italian to discuss the situation last week.

    He will combine his new role with his job as Arsenal's head of youth development after being given permission by Gunners boss Arsene Wenger.

    The 52-year-old Brady, who won 72 Republic caps between 1974 and 1990, will join Marco Tardelli and Fausto Rossi as part of Trapattoni's backroom team.
